House Journal: Page 1966: Wednesday, April 26, 1995

BILLS SIGNED BY THE GOVERNOR
A communication was received from the Governor announcing that
on April 25, 1995, he approved and transmitted to the Secretary
of State the following bills:
House File 113, an act relating to the definition of resident
for the purpose of obtaining licenses to hunt, fish, trap, or
take protected species of animals and providing for other
properly related matters.
House File 128, an act relating to administrative procedures and
the joint investment of funds of rural water districts.
House File 139, an act relating to the disclosure of the methods
used by insurance companies and nonprofit health service
corporations to determine the usual and customary fees for
dental care benefit coverages.
House File 217, an act relating to education requirements for
nurses.
House File 289, an act relating to solid waste tonnage fees.
House File 346, an act relating to the verification and
defendant's signature required for uniform citations and
complaints and to providing false information on a uniform
citation and complaint and making an existing penalty applicable.
House File 483, an act relating to activities of the department
of human services, including provisions involving the state
hospital-schools and other institutions, commitments of persons
with mental retardation, and the department's public housing
unit.
House File 554, an act relating to state and local taxes
including appeals of department of revenue and finance actions,
the prohibition of unconstitutional or illegal tax collections,
assessment procedures pertaining to amended returns, corporate
income tax rates, sales tax on test laboratory services,
collection of sales tax by out-of-state retailers, interest
accrual on sales and use tax refunds, sales tax permit denial
for delinquent taxes, bonding provisions for sales tax and
environmental protection charge contested case decisions, costs
associated with contested case hearings, penalty for
underpayment of corporation income and franchise taxes, services
subject to use tax, penalty for underpayment of use tax, the
repeal of obsolete property tax provisions, and imposition of
the drug excise tax on unprocessed marijuana plants and
providing effective and applicability date provisions.
House File 556, an act relating to the definition of entities
eligible for property tax exemption for construction of
speculative shell buildings.
Also: The Governor announced that on April 26, 1995, he approved
and transmitted to the Secretary of State the following bills:
Senate File 82, an act relating to medical assistance provisions
including those relating to presumptive eligibility for pregnant
women and the estates and trusts of recipients of medical
assistance and providing an effective date.
Senate File 87, an act relating to nonsubstantive Code
corrections, and providing effective and applicability date
provisions.
Senate File 132, an act relating to compensation for victims of
crimes, by providing for compensation to secondary victims of
crimes and increasing the maximum amount that may be recovered
for loss of work income due to injuries received by victims.
